Eco-Friendly Materials That Stand the Test of Time


Sustainable construction begins with choosing the right materials. In Colorado, weather is notoriously unpredictable, from spring snow to blazing summer sun. Segura Stone specializes in high-quality, locally sourced stone and climate-adaptive concrete mixes that minimize environmental impact and maximize resilience.


Explore these sustainable options:


  • Locally quarried stone: Reduces transportation emissions and supports Colorado businesses.
  • Recycled concrete aggregates: Gives new life to old materials, lessening landfill waste.
  • Permeable pavers: Improve stormwater management and reduce runoff by allowing water infiltration.

Responsible Design & Construction Practices


Sustainability isn’t just about materials—it’s about thoughtful design and professional execution tailored to Colorado’s topography and climate. Segura Stone’s team collaborates closely with clients to integrate ecological features such as:


  • Retaining walls that prevent soil erosion and protect native plant life on sloped properties.
  • Smart grading and drainage solutions that manage runoff in high rainfall or snowmelt seasons.
  • Xeriscape-friendly patios and walkways that reduce water use while enhancing outdoor living.

Seasonal Tips for Sustainable Landscaping


April’s changing temperatures inspire many Colorado families to refresh their outdoor spaces. Here are a few spring tips to keep sustainability at the forefront:


  • Choose native or drought-resistant ground covers near masonry features to reduce irrigation needs.
  • Schedule regular inspections of retaining walls and walkways to catch potential erosion early.
  • Consider incorporating permeable pavers on driveways and patios to support healthy groundwater recharge.
